In a recent meeting with NATO Secretary General Mark Rutte, President Trump announced that they have agreed to the framework of a “long-term deal” on Greenland and the Arctic region. The meeting, which took place in Davos, Switzerland, was described by the President as “very productive” and has created a positive outlook for the future of the region.

During the meeting, President Trump highlighted the importance of the Arctic region and the potential it holds for economic growth and development. He also emphasized the need for cooperation and collaboration among nations in order to effectively utilize the resources of the region.

The President’s announcement of a “long-term deal” on Greenland and the Arctic region has been met with great enthusiasm and optimism. This deal, which is being negotiated by Vice President JD Vance, Secretary of State Marco Rubio, Special Envoy Steve Witkoff, and other administration officials, has the potential to bring about significant benefits for all parties involved.

One of the key aspects of this deal is the suspension of tariffs on eight NATO members. This decision, which was made during the meeting with Mark Rutte, is a clear indication of the progress being made in negotiations.
